The purpose of this role is to support the implementation of specific business strategies by contributing to business development and growth through cultivating relationships with designated clients and making informed underwriting decisions to enhance the profitability of the portfolio. Key responsibilities involve generating new business, retaining renewals, and ensuring the overall profitability of a specific designated book of business within our Specialty insurance vertical

Your new role
Review, evaluate and price business by applying underwriting judgment and adhering to regulations.
Underwrite new and existing policies in compliance with organizational standards and regulatory requirements.
Identify and minimize risks through due diligence and escalation of issues when necessary.
Comply with legal and regulatory requirements.
Contribute to recording and measurement of insurance risks.
Establish and maintain relationships with producers and customers.
Research and obtain market intelligence to enhance profit goals.
Contribute to special projects and department initiatives.
